Approval English Meaning

Energy storage project grid access approval

Energy storage project grid access approval

The DOE Global Energy Storage Database provides research-grade information on grid-connected energy storage projects and relevant state and federal policies. All data can be exported to Excel or JSON format. [PDF Version]

How do you say energy storage system in English

How do you say energy storage system in English

An Energy Storage System (ESS) is the coordinated combination of electrochemical storage (e., lithium-ion cells), power electronics, battery management, thermal control, and functional safety that captures energy when it is abundant and delivers it reliably when it is needed. [PDF Version]

Meaning of energy storage system

Meaning of energy storage system

Energy storage is the capture of produced at one time for use at a later time to reduce imbalances between energy demand and energy production. A device that stores energy is generally called an or. Energy comes in multiple forms including radiation,,,, electricity, elevated temperature, and. Energy storage involves converting ene. [PDF Version]

Suspension car meaning

Suspension car meaning

A car's suspension is the complex system of springs, shock absorbers, and linkages that connects the vehicle to its wheels. [PDF Version]

FAQs about Suspension car meaning

What is a suspension bush on a car?

The suspension bush acts as a vibration isolator and is constructed of rubber. It prevents any metal-to-metal contact but still allows some movemen.

.

Related Articles

Technical Documentation

Download BESS datasheets, pricing guides, and storage system specifications.

Contact MEMO-GRID BESS Offices

Italy HQ (Rome)

Via Monte Rosa, 91
20149 Milan, Italy

Phone

Italy (Sales): +39 06 8732 5419

Italy (Support): +39 335 728 3641

Mon-Fri: 9:00 AM – 6:00 PM (CET)